Job Summary
We are looking for a passionate and experienced Infant Teacher to work with 0 - 2 year olds for 35 - 40 hours a week, or. In this role, you'll have autonomy in planning daily routines, providing responsive care, and supporting early developmental milestones, while fostering a safe and nurturing classroom atmosphere. If you love nurturing the youngest learners and promoting sensory, emotional, social, and physical growth from the earliest stages, this is the perfect opportunity to make a difference.

Key Responsibilities
Child Development and Care

  • Plan and implement age-appropriate activities promoting sensory exploration, motor skills, emotional bonding, and basic cognitive development for infants.
  • Conduct regular observations of infants’ progress and maintain developmental records.
  • Adapt caregiving methods to meet individual needs, including those of infants with special needs or varying temperaments.
  • Foster a nurturing, inclusive classroom environment encouraging attachment, comfort, and gentle exploration.

Environment and Resource Management

  • Design and arrange the classroom layout to facilitate safe play, rest, and caregiving while ensuring infant safety.
  • Select and organize age-appropriate materials and resources, such as soft toys, mobiles, and sensory items, to support daily routines.
  • Conduct regular safety checks, including sanitation of toys and equipment, and ensure compliance with health and safety regulations for infants.
  • Manage classroom budget for supplies and materials, if applicable.

Communication and Collaboration

  • Establish regular communication with parents (e.g., newsletters, emails, apps) to share updates on feeding, sleeping, and developmental milestones.
  • Conduct parent-teacher conferences to discuss infants’ progress and address concerns.
  • Collaborate with colleagues to plan and implement center-wide events or themes suitable for all ages.
  • Participate in team meetings to discuss classroom needs and share best practices.

Leadership and Professional Growth

  • Mentor and guide aides in their professional development, with a focus on infant care techniques.
  • Participate in ongoing professional development (e.g., workshops, courses) related to infant care and early development.
  • Stay current with research and best practices in infant and toddler education.
  • Contribute to the center’s professional learning community by sharing knowledge.

Qualifications

  •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education, Child Development, or a related field (preferred).
  • At least 2 years of experience in an infant or early childhood setting, with lead teaching experience a plus.
  • Strong understanding of infant development principles and responsive caregiving methods.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and leadership sk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ment.
  • Current CPR/First Aid certification (infant-specific preferred) and background check required (or willingness to obtain).
  • Bilingual skills (English/Spanish) are a bonus.
